Position Overview
We, at Leggett & Platt Inc., are searching for a Supply Chain Analyst within our Global Procurement team to help support our business. As a global‑diversified manufacturing company, we provide high‑quality components that power everyday products such as mattresses, cars, planes, and furniture. Your work will help ensure people across the world have a more comfortable experience.
Responsibilities- Examine workflow and apply analytical and quantitative methods to understand, predict, and streamline business processes, enhancing supply‑chain efficiency.
- Design, maintain, and analyze supply‑chain metrics.
- Execute and maintain ad‑hoc analysis across the organization.
- Collaborate cross‑functionally to define assumptions, query data, build models, and align stakeholders on analytical processes, producing actionable insights.
- Perform data entry, validation, daily reporting, and UAT testing on new systems.
- Gather and integrate relevant data quickly and adapt existing plans to new information.
- Support collaboration efforts across functions and manage initiatives and projects from ideation to execution.
- Bachelor’s degree in supply‑chain management, mathematics, data science, business, or related field preferred.
- 3–5+ years of industry experience in data analysis and developing business cases.
- 2+ years of experience in dashboarding, data visualization, and reporting.
- 2+ years of experience in SQL and manipulating large data sets in a database.
- Advanced proficiency in SQL, ETL, data modeling, and working with “Big Data.”
- Excellent problem‑solving skills.
- Excited to learn new technologies and analytical methodologies related to business intelligence and data analysis.
- Strong communication (verbal and written) and interpersonal skills to translate ambiguous business requirements into complex analyses and actionable insights.
- A deep understanding of metrics, reporting tools, and data structures.
- Experience in an MRP environment strongly preferred.
- Excellent verbal skills.
- Ability to be a self‑starter and work in groups or alone on projects.
- Ability to align with forward vision and proactively seek solutions to achieve the company’s vision.
